Businesses increase market share by mastering customer insight

Marketing guides stress that many companies overestimate their knowledge of customers, relying on simple demographics instead of deeper layers of motivation and behavior. Effective audience research moves beyond a one‑sentence profile to cover buying stage, language, concerns, and influencing factors, enabling better product positioning, pricing and ad spend.

For small businesses, uncovering buyer motivation is especially critical. Studies cited claim that 95% of purchase decisions are subconscious and that firms that understand these drivers can achieve roughly 1.8 times the market share of competitors. Direct conversation with customers, testimonial collection tools and AI‑powered text analysis are recommended ways to capture hidden triggers, allowing firms to pivot quickly as preferences shift and to compete against larger, well‑funded brands.
